Signs of Blue Light Toxicity in Plants

Not sure if your plants are getting too much blue light? Look for these warning signs:

🔹 Slow Growth – Instead of lush, rapid development, plants may grow at a sluggish pace.

🔹 Leaf Curling – Leaves may appear curled or twisted, signaling stress.

🔹 Purple or Reddish Hue – Some plants react to excessive blue light by developing a discoloration.

🔹 Stunted Stretching – While blue light promotes short, compact growth, an extreme amount may cause plants to stay too small.

🔹 Delayed Flowering – If plants are stuck in the vegetative phase longer than expected, excessive blue light could be the culprit.



How to Balance Blue Light in LED Grow Lights

LED grow lights give you control over light intensity and spectrum. To prevent blue light toxicity, keep these tips in mind:

🔹 Adjust Light Distance – Position LED grow lights at an optimal distance to prevent excessive exposure.

🔹 Use a Full-Spectrum Setup – A balanced mix of blue, red, and other wavelengths supports overall plant health.

🔹 Monitor Plant Response – Observe plant behavior and adjust light settings accordingly.

🔹 Introduce Gradually – If increasing blue light levels, do so slowly to let plants adapt.

🔹 Time It Right – Blue light is beneficial during the vegetative stage but should be balanced when transitioning to flowering.

FAQs

1. How much blue light do plants need from LED grow lights?

Plants typically need 10-30% blue light in their spectrum for optimal growth. The exact amount depends on the plant type and growth stage.


2. Can blue light alone grow plants?

Yes, but not efficiently. While blue light supports vegetative growth, a combination of red, white, and far-red light ensures balanced development and flowering.


3. How do I fix blue light toxicity in my grow setup?

If you suspect blue light toxicity, try increasing red light exposure, adjusting light distance, or reducing blue light intensity for a more balanced spectrum.
